Rousey sends a message
Adam Pearce was in the ring for the contract signing, and Introduced first Charlotte Flair and then Ronda Rousey.
Once they were in the ring, Pearce realized they didn’t have the contract and Drew Gulak ran it out. He’s Pearce’s new assistant.
Gulak offered to show a power point presentation about the rules of an I Quit match and Flair threatened to make him cry he quits again.

Ronda told her to leave him be and Flair informed her the only rule is to make their opponent say “I quit.”
She then listed ways to make Ronda say she quits and then she signed the contract.
Ronda countered that there’ll be no ref to step in and save her and Flair kept saying she beat her at WrestleMania.
Flair flipped the table and pulled out a kendo stick, but Ronda took her down and used the endo stick on Flair.
Gulak took it away, and Ronda hit a Samoan Drop on him and locked in an armbar while she signed.
Xavier Woods w/Kofi Kingston vs. Butch w/Sheamus and Ridge Holland
Woods rolled Butch up for a pair of pin attempts to start it off, then continued to hammer away with chops.
Butch turned it around and pounded on Woods, then worked on his left arm with a double knee drop and joint manipulation.

Woods sent Butch to the floor and dropkicked him across the announce table. A confrontation ensued and Butch took out Woods with a flying punch, then was restrained from going after Kofi as we headed to commercial.
Woods came back after taking plenty of punishment and dropped Butch with a leg sweep, but Butch grabbed his ear of get off Woods’ shoulder and hit a suiplex slam for a pin attempt.
Butch went for a DDT but Woods countered with a Back Woods for the win.
After the match, Butch threw a security guy over the barricade and headed through the fans.

GUNTHER w/Ludwig Kaiser vs. Teddy Goodz
GUNTHER went to work on Teddy’s left arm and slammed him through an armbar, then then brushed off a dropkick before hitting a big boot.
GUNTHER kept abusing Teddy with ease before locking in a Sleeper and turning it around for a powerbomb and pin.
Riddle w/Randy Orton vs. Jey Uso w/Jimmy Uso
Riddle took Jey down right off the bat and went for a submission but Jey made it to the ropes to break it.
Jey threw Riddle off when he tried for a sleeper, and then hammered on Riddle before he ran into a kick.
Jey took over and nailed Riddle with several chops, the rolled out of the ring when Riddle went for a kick for a breather and caught Riddle’s dive through the ropes with a forearm and threw Riddle into the ring steps.

Jey suplexed Riddle onto the announce desk as we headed to commercial.
Riddle fought back and hit a Final Flash, then a Floating Bro for a near pinfall.
Riddle hit a draping DDT, and Orton dropped Jimmy on the announce table when he tried to distract Riddle.
Jey fought off an RKO and hit a pop up neckbreaker for a near pinfall.
Jey ran into a running knee, but hit a superkick. Riddle got his knees up to counter an Uso Splash and rolled Jey up for the win.
This was an awesome back and forth match.
